verb

  1. To dislocate; to displace a body part.
    “If in cases of difficulty you have recourse to this means, luxate downwards as far as half the dorsopalmar diameter, and then vice versa.”

adj

  1. Dislocated.

Etymology

From Latin luxātus (“dislocated”) perfect passive participle of lū̆xō (“to dislocate”), see -ate (verb-forming suffix) for more.
